Jamie Larsen Helmet photograph

Jamie Larsen

New Zealand
Date of birth:September 19, 1992 (19 y/o)
Races entered:14
Wins:4
Podiums:8
Race win percentage:28.57%
(the above statistics are a summary of the data currently available on the Career details page.)
